Recent research has shed light on the potential cognitive benefits of participating in team sports for children. The study indicates that engaging in athletic activities not only promotes physical health but also contributes positively to brain development. Children who play team sports often exhibit improved problem-solving skills, enhanced concentration, and better academic performance.
The collaborative nature of team sports encourages communication and teamwork, which are essential skills in both social and academic settings. As children navigate the challenges of working with peers, they develop critical thinking and decision-making abilities. Moreover, the discipline and commitment required in sports can foster a strong work ethic, which translates into their academic pursuits.
Additionally, the study highlights that regular physical activity can lead to improved mental health, reducing symptoms of anxiety and depression. This holistic approach to development suggests that parents and educators should encourage participation in team sports as a valuable component of a child's growth and learning journey.
